Eighteen missiles of various configurations have been flight tested, and all of the components and systems have performed correctly. The major accomplishments of this program have been: 1) the proven capability of the design team to develop and flight test a complete fluidic control system in a reasonable schedule and for a reasonable cost, and 2) the proven repeatability, reliability, and ruggedness of the fluidics components during the experimental programs.
